Abstract

The utility model discloses a multifunctional chair for hip fracture patients, which comprises a seat board, a backrest and armrests, wherein a restraint device is arranged on the backrest, an object placing part is arranged on the armrests, a base is arranged at the lower position of the seat board, the base is connected with the bottom of the seat board through a jacking device, and chair legs are arranged at the bottom of the base. The lifting device is arranged under the seat plate, the lifting control button is arranged on the outer side wall of the armrest, the lifting device is controlled by the lifting control button, when a patient sits on the chair, the chair is adjusted to reach a reasonable height, so that the angle of the hip joint meets the requirement, and the rehabilitation of the patient is facilitated; in addition, the utility model is provided with a restraint device and anti-skid foot pads, so that the safety of the patient when the patient leaves the bed and sits is ensured; meanwhile, a small table plate is further arranged on the chair, so that articles can be placed conveniently, the chair can be stored when not used, and the space is not occupied.

Description

Multifunctional chair for hip fracture patient
Technical Field
The utility model relates to the field of medical instruments, in particular to a multifunctional chair for a hip fracture patient.
Background
Hip fracture refers to a fracture of the proximal femur, i.e., the upper thigh, near the hip joint. Hip fracture, including femoral neck fracture, intertrochanteric fracture, femoral neck fracture is the fracture between the head and neck junction area of femur to the base of femoral neck, intertrochanteric fracture refers to the fracture that takes place at the base of femoral neck to the position above the lesser trochanter level. Following hip fracture, the condition can be improved by local reduction therapy. After the body is gradually improved, the bed can be properly moved under the accompany of a family, so that the muscle atrophy caused by long-time bed rest is avoided, and the body rehabilitation after fracture can be even influenced. Therefore, after the fracture reduction treatment, the patient can move properly in about one week.
The early movement of a patient after an operation can promote the recovery of organs and functions, and the early movement of leaving a bed after the operation is evaluated, such as a bedside stool and the like, and the hip joint of the patient is required to be bent by no more than 90 degrees, otherwise fracture complications (such as hip adduction and the like) can be caused; the height of the stool used in daily life is generally 45-55 cm, when a patient sits, the hip joint is bent by more than 90 degrees, and the stool is not suitable for being used for early stage after operation of the hip fracture patient.
Accordingly, the present invention solves the above problems by providing a multi-function chair for early out-of-bed activities of patients with hip fractures.
SUMMERY OF THE UTILITY MODEL
The utility model mainly aims to provide a multifunctional chair for a hip fracture patient.
In order to achieve the purpose, the utility model provides the following technical scheme: a multifunctional chair for hip fracture patients comprises a seat board, a backrest and armrests, wherein a restraint device is arranged on the backrest, an object placing part is arranged on the armrests, a base is arranged at the position below the seat board and connected with the bottom of the seat board through a jacking device, and chair legs are arranged at the bottom of the base.
On the basis of the above scheme and as a preferable scheme of the scheme: the jacking device comprises a driving motor and a telescopic rod, wherein the driving motor is installed at the central position of the base, a motor shaft of the driving motor is connected with the central position of the bottom of the seat plate, the telescopic rod comprises an installation sleeve and a connecting rod body, the installation sleeve is fixedly installed on the upper surface of the base, the connecting rod body is sleeved on the installation sleeve, and the connecting rod body is fixedly connected with the bottom of the seat plate.
On the basis of the above scheme and as a preferable scheme of the scheme: the object placing part comprises a small table plate, a cover plate and a containing cavity, the small table plate can be contained in the containing cavity, and the cover plate is movably arranged at the top of the containing cavity.
On the basis of the above scheme and as a preferable scheme of the scheme: the restraint device comprises a plug buckle and a restraint strap, one end of the restraint strap is fixedly connected with the backrest, and the other end of the restraint strap is connected with the backrest through the plug buckle.
On the basis of the above scheme and as a preferable scheme of the scheme: and a lifting control switch is also arranged on the outer side wall of the handrail.
On the basis of the above scheme and as a preferable scheme of the scheme: the bottom of the chair leg is provided with an anti-skid pad foot.
On the basis of the above scheme and as a preferable scheme of the scheme: when the jacking device jacks the seat plate, the jacking height is 10 cm.
The utility model has the following beneficial effects:
(1) the lifting device is arranged under the seat plate, the lifting control button is arranged on the outer side wall of the armrest, the lifting device is controlled by the lifting control button, when a patient sits on the chair, the chair is adjusted to reach a reasonable height, the angle of the hip joint meets the requirement, and the rehabilitation of the patient is facilitated.
(2) The utility model is provided with the restraint device and the anti-skid foot pads, so that the safety of a patient when the patient leaves a bed and sits is ensured; meanwhile, a small table plate is further arranged on the chair, so that articles can be placed conveniently, the chair can be stored when not used, and the space is not occupied.

Referring to fig. 1 of the drawings, the multifunctional chair for the hip fracture patient in the embodiment comprises a seat plate 20, a backrest 10 and armrests 30, wherein a restraining device is arranged on the backrest 10, an article placing part is arranged on the armrests 30, a base 40 is arranged below the seat plate 20, the base 40 is connected with the bottom of the seat plate 20 through a lifting device, and chair legs 41 are arranged at the bottom of the base 40. In this embodiment, the seat board 20, the backrest 10 and the armrests 30 are all integrally formed, the base 40 is a rectangular structure, when in use, pillows capable of increasing the comfort of patients can be laid on the seat board 20 and the backrest 10, the restraint device comprises a buckle 11 and a restraint belt 12, the buckle 11 is arranged on the side wall of the backrest 10, one end of the restraint belt 12 is fixedly connected with the backrest 10, and the other end is connected with the backrest 10 through the buckle 11; meanwhile, the bottom positions of the chair legs 41 are further provided with anti-slip pads 410, in the embodiment, four chair legs 41 are respectively arranged on four corners of the base 40 with the rectangular structure, and the anti-slip pads 410 are respectively arranged at the bottom positions of the four chair legs 41, so that the safety of a patient when the patient leaves the bed and sits on the restraint strap 12 and the anti-slip pads 410 can be ensured.
Preferably, the jacking device includes a driving motor 42 and a telescopic rod, the driving motor 42 is installed at the central position of the base 40, a motor shaft 420 of the driving motor 42 is connected with the central position of the bottom of the seat plate 20, the telescopic rod includes a mounting sleeve 43 and a connecting rod body 430, the mounting sleeve 43 is fixedly installed at four corners of the upper surface of the base 40, the connecting rod body 430 is sleeved on the mounting sleeve 43, and the connecting rod body 430 is fixedly connected with the bottom of the seat plate 20. In this embodiment, the motor shaft 420 is movably connected to the driving motor 42, the driving motor 42 is installed on the base 40, and the free end of the motor shaft 420 is fixedly connected to the bottom of the seat plate 20; further preferably, the outer side wall of the handrail 30 is further provided with a lifting control switch, the lifting control switch is electrically connected with the driving motor 42, the lifting control switch comprises a lifting control switch 300 and a descending control switch 301, the lifting control switch 300 is used for controlling the lifting movement of the jacking device, and the descending control switch 301 is used for controlling the descending movement of the jacking device; further preferably, when the lifting device lifts the seat plate 20, the lifting height is 10cm, actually the height of the seat plate of the common chair from the ground is usually 55cm, and after the height is adjusted, the height of the seat plate of the chair from the ground is 65cm, which can meet the requirement of hip joint angle and is beneficial to the rehabilitation of patients.
In order to facilitate the patient to place the object, the preferred object placing part of the embodiment includes a small table 31, a cover plate 32 and an accommodating cavity, the small table 31 can be accommodated in the accommodating cavity, and the cover plate 32 is movably disposed at the top of the accommodating cavity through a hinge. In this embodiment, the small table plates 31 are disposed on the two armrests 30, the connection relationship between the small table plates 31 and the accommodating cavities is regarded as the prior art, and this embodiment is not described in detail.
